JUST-IN: Army Lance Corporal Arrested over N4.9m Robbery
A serving member of the Nigerian Army, identified as Lance Corporal Chukwu Ebuka, has been arrested in Abia State for allegedly participating in a r+bbery operation that left a victim dispossessed of nearly N5 million.
In the video , the soldier, who is attached to the 14 Brigade in Ohafia, allegedly carried out the operation alongside two other accomplices. He was apprehended shortly after the incident by security authorities.
Items reportedly recovered from the suspect include two axes and a pair of handcuffs believed to have been used during the robbery.
In the video currently circulating online the soldier was being questioned by a superior officer, where he appeared visibly distressed while admitting involvement in the crime and pleading for mercy. In the footage, Ebuka repeatedly acknowledged that his actions were wrong.
“My action was wrong… it was not right,” he said during the interrogation.
